Entry Requirements by Program Level


ENGINEERING PROGRAMS

N4 Level:

  • N3 Certificate, OR
  • Grade 12 with Mathematics and Physical Science (minimum 40%)
  • English (minimum 40%)

N5 Level:

  • N4 Certificate with all subjects passed

N6 Level:

  • N5 Certificate with all subjects passed


BUSINESS PROGRAMS

N4 Level:

  • Grade 12 certificate (any stream)
  • English/Afrikaans (minimum 40%)
  • Mathematics or Mathematical Literacy (minimum 40%)

N5 Level:

  • N4 Certificate with all subjects passed

N6 Level:

  • N5 Certificate with all subjects passed

Recognition of Prior Learning (RPL)

If you have relevant work experience but lack formal qualifications, you may qualify through RPL assessment.

Who Can Apply?

  • Individuals with at least 3 years relevant work experience
  • No formal qualification but demonstrable skills
  • Previous incomplete studies

How to Apply for RPL:

  1. Submit RPL application form
  2. Provide detailed CV and employment records
  3. Complete practical assessment
  4. Portfolio of evidence

Refund Policy

Before Semester Starts:

  • 90% refund if withdrawal is before semester start date
  • 10% administration fee retained

After Semester Starts:

  • No refund for first month
  • 50% refund if withdrawal within first month
  • No refund after one month of attendance

Registration fees are non-refundable under all circumstances.
